ALICE Mobile App – Visitors Page
This document walks through how to view, filter, and check out visitors using the ALICE Mobile App's Visitors page.
The Visitor page lets you view, manage, and contact visitors who have checked in with you on the ALICE Directory. The visitor card includes their name, where they checked in, and time they checked in.
Viewing Visitors Records
By default, the Visitor page shows all Active Visitors you are hosting, with the latest visitor appearing at the top of the page. Swiping down on the page will refresh the list with the latest information.
Setting a Filter
Additional filtering options are available by selecting the icon in the top left corner of the Visitor page. This will allow you to see both Active Visitors and past visitors.

Show Active Visitors only – When enabled, only active visitors will appear.

Choose Date / Range – Select the range of dates that the report will pull from by tapping the start and end dates.

Change the month by tapping left and right to move to the previous or following month.

To change the year, select the down arrow by the year listed. The calendar will change to a year view. Tapping the year will open the months within that year. Tap the month to reopen the calendar. Years appear in 10-year intervals. Tap the left and right arrow buttons to navigate to a previous or future set of years.

Clearing a Filter
When filters are applied, the properties of the filter appear at the top of the Visitor page. To clear the property, select the x button by each filter.
Once all filters are removed, the list will have its default settings.
Visitor Detail View
Selecting the visitor card will open a detailed view of their check-in information.
Guest Info
The Guest Info tab includes information provided on the Check-in Form on the ALICE Directory.

Name – The visitor's first and last name.

Company – The company the visitor is representing.

Mobile – The visitor's mobile number.

Email – The visitor's email address.
Documents Tab
The Document tab includes any induction materials the visitor reviewed, acknowledged, and signed. If the material has been signed or acknowledged, a check mark will appear by the induction material.
Screening Tab
The screening tab includes information on any screening processes against which the visitor was checked.
Contacting a Visitor
If a visitor has provided their mobile number or email, they can be contacted using the ALICE Mobile App.
Contact Through Visitor Card
The visitor can be contacted through their visitor card using the three dots at the top right corner of the card.
A pop-up window will appear with three options.
- Call – Opens your phone app and pre-populates the visitor's number.
- Send Text – Opens your phone's text messaging app and automatically populates the visitor's number.
- Send Email – Opens your phone's email app and automatically populates the visitor's email.
Contact Through Visitor Detail
The visitor can be contacted through the Visitor Detail view after tapping the visitor's card.
Three buttons can be used to contact the visitor.

SMS Text Message Button (Left) – Opens your phone's text messaging app and automatically populates the visitor's number.

Phone Call Button (Middle) – Opens your phone app and pre-populates the visitor's number.

Email Button (Right) – Opens your phone's email app and automatically populates the visitor's email.
Checking Out Visitors
Visitors can check themselves out on the ALICE Directory. However, if they fail to do so, their host can check them out using the ALICE Mobile App.
There are two different options for checking a visitor out.
Check Out Through the Visitor Card
Visitors can be checked out through their visitor card using the three dots at the top right corner.
A pop-up window will appear. Tap the Checkout option at the bottom of the list. A checkout confirmation will appear once the request has been processed.
Check Out Through Visitor Detail View
The visitor can be contacted through the Visitor Detail view after tapping the visitor's card.
At the bottom of the detailed view, tap the orange Checkout button. A checkout confirmation will appear once the request has been processed.
